Statement

Cesar Rey has created a flawless body of sculptural work with discarded materials, household waste, or ready-mades found in workshops. The originality of his work -at a time when the word appears to be senseless– is derived in the first place from the unique relationship he establishes with every creature that emerges from his hands in a way that transforms recycling into a practice. In the solitude of his home or his studio, Rey generates - and lives with- those unexpected, organic three dimensional shapes that are capable of eliciting associations with realms of nature, while at the same time they originate in a very personal mythical kingdom.
